[Comprehensive Selection/Reskilling] Create an App in 2 Days with No Experience! 'Generative AI x Zero-to-One Entrepreneurship Bootcamp' to be Held in Kachidoki on May 16-17
The Children's Education Creation Organization and Co-Creation Organization Inc. are hosting a 2-day 'Generative AI x Zero-to-One Entrepreneurship Bootcamp' on May 16-17, 2026. The workshop is designed for individuals without programming experience, including students, to turn their business ideas into functional app prototypes using generative AI. The program focuses on self-exploration to develop a solid idea and provides hands-on support to overcome technical hurdles.

The General Incorporated Association Children's Education Creation Organization and Co-Creation Organization Inc. will hold a hands-on workshop, 'Generative AI x Zero-to-One Entrepreneurship Bootcamp 2Days,' where even those without programming experience can turn their business ideas into apps using generative AI. The event will take place on Saturday, May 16, and Sunday, May 17, 2026, at the Kindery International Kachidoki-Tsukishima campus.
■ Background and Purpose of the Event
We planned this program to solve challenges such as, "I have an idea I want to explore for the comprehensive selection university entrance exam, but I don't have the skills to develop a verification app," and "I'm interested in starting a business, but I don't know where to begin." An era has arrived where anyone can quickly develop a "working prototype" without writing a single line of code by utilizing the latest generative AI tools (like Replit and Google AI Studio).
This bootcamp doesn't start with development right away. Instead, it begins with "self-exploration," where participants thoroughly delve into their own personal experiences and strong feelings of discomfort.
By building on the passion of "Whose problem, what kind of problem, and why am I the one to solve it?" we help participants discover the seeds of a solid business. It is also an ideal program for high school and university students to discover their own career perspectives and take on new challenges.
We provide an environment where working adults and students can interact on a level playing field, transcending age and titles, as fellow "entrepreneurs tackling the zero-to-one challenge."
